Transaction 656bcbe75c7f5b60329bc6958ffc50918aa98a2dbf98b310db7250e81e13c502

3 Input
2 Outputs
  • 656bcbe75c7f5b60329bc6958ffc50918aa98a2dbf98b310db7250e81e13c502:0
  • value  5990600
    address  1FXRcvT2vinGbpkuKfSKhS3G2n81ymNscR
  • 656bcbe75c7f5b60329bc6958ffc50918aa98a2dbf98b310db7250e81e13c502:1
  • value  45782
    address  1MBPqBTsmByKLdCp4PCX3ozHhatZvJb16q